Comprehending Suspension in Prams
Before diving into the models and functions, it's necessary to comprehend what suspension implies in the context of prams. Suspension refers to the system of springs or shock absorbers that helps to cushion the pram versus bumps and shocks, offering a more steady and comfortable trip.
Why is Suspension Important?Comfort for Baby: A smooth trip reduces pain for infants, particularly when they are sleeping.Alleviate of Use for Parents: Prams with good suspension are simpler to navigate and need less effort to push over irregular surfaces.Security: Reduced vibration indicates less chance of jarring movements that can impact a baby's delicate body.Types of Suspension in Prams
Suspension systems can vary substantially among prams. Here are the most common types:

What is the distinction between single and double suspension?
Single suspension enables each wheel to soak up shocks separately, while double suspension uses two systems on each side for much better control over bumps.
2. Are prams with suspension more expensive?
Yes, prams Stroller With Suspension advanced suspension systems can be more costly due to the innovation and materials utilized.
3. How do I know if a pram's suspension is good?
Consider evaluations from other moms and dads, test it in-store if possible, and search for models particularly developed for difficult terrains.
4. Are there any upkeep requires for suspension?
Yes, examine the suspension systems frequently for wear and tear, and replace any worn-out components.
5. Can I use a pram with suspension on all surfaces?
While lots of prams with suspension are developed for different surfaces, not All Terrain Buggy UK prams perform equally on extremely rugged surfaces. Constantly check specifications and user evaluations for guidance.
